AM. BANK & TRUST CO. v. LICHTENSTEIN


48 A.D.2d 790 (1975)

American Bank & Trust Company, Appellant, v. Morton Lichtenstein et al., Respondents

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

June 12, 1975


During the period of 1967 through 1970 plaintiff loaned to the defendant over $5 million. The loans were represented by promissory notes, payable on demand and in addition, each of the defendants executed written guarantees for payment to the plaintiff of the obligations of each of the other defendants.
